Hey! Welcome to the Driftwell on-call rotation. The read-replica lag alarm fires more than you'd expect — usually it's a bulk import, not a real problem. Check lag trend first; if it's climbing past ten minutes, escalate. Otherwise just ack and note it. The full triage steps are on the page below.

dashboard of tawef-hagug = https://superset.norvadyn.local/display/projects/build/ticket/build/spaces/ticket/1e989f0e6c200d20fc4ae06b

## Onboarding: Graphlet Support Basics

Graphlet renders dependency graphs for customer builds. Support handles three things: stuck render jobs, stale cache complaints, and export failures. Restart the renderer via the admin panel; never touch the worker hosts directly. Graph metadata lives in the `graphlet_meta` database — read-only for support. When a ticket needs a metadata lookup, open your SQL client and connect using the following connection string.

replica DSN, yahaf-yagaf: mongodb://tamath_svc:a2netSk3RZMuTj@db-d084.novacsoft.internal:5432/ralmir

The renewal of our three-year agreement with Torvane Materials has been assessed in detail. Proposed terms include a 4.2% unit-price increase, partially offset by improved volume rebates and extended payment terms of sixty days. Sensitivity analysis indicates a net annual cost impact of under 1% on the Meridia product line, assuming stable demand. Legal has flagged no material changes to liability clauses. We recommend approval, subject to the conditions outlined in the confidential note below.

confidential, yawip-bahif: Zorokox Partners plans to lower the Casax list price by 28.0 percent in April. The board signed off on a budget of $271.0 million for Project Juldor. The renewal with Pelokox Partners closes at $410.1 million a year, 3.4 percent below the last contract. Project Pelok slips by a full year because of the audit delay.

# Break-Glass: Catalog Cache Invalidation

Scope: the Pinrow product catalog at Veldstone Retail. If stale prices persist after a purge and the Hollowmere invalidation queue is wedged, use break-glass to flush the edge tier directly. Contractors: get verbal sign-off from the catalog lead first. Steps: open the Hollowmere admin shell, select emergency-flush, confirm the tenant, and run it once — repeated flushes thrash the origin. Access is logged and expires after 20 minutes. Unseal the admin shell with the passphrase below.

recovery phrase for kahop-tajog: istix-casvan